Can I Afford Central Carolina Technical College?

11% Take Out Loans
15.4% Loan Default Rate

Student Loan Debt

It's not uncommon for college students to take out loans to pay for school. In fact, almost 66% of students nationwide depend at least partially on loans. At Central Carolina, approximately 11% of students took out student loans averaging $3,983 a year. That adds up to $15,932 over four years for those students.

The student loan default rate at Central Carolina is 15.4%. Watch out! This is significantly higher than the national default rate of 10.1%, which means you could have trouble paying back your student loans if you take any out.

There are 2,885 undergraduate students at Central Carolina, with 904 being full-time and 1,981 being part-time.

undefined

Gender Diversity

Of the 904 full-time undergraduates at Central Carolina, 40% are male and 60% are female.
